You'd have to live under a rock (or in the ocean) not to have heard about the health benefits of eating fish.
Like so many things, when there's an upside, there's also a downside. For fish, the downside is the risks of ingesting toxic substances when you're eating your fish.
The health benefits of fish are well researched and documented. Because fish are high in omega-3 fatty oils, eating fish can reduce chances of heart attacks and the overall risk of death.
